Thoughts on the Frontiers special Brent. I thought it was solid in places and dire in others. Vocals are excellent as you would expect.


I pretty much concur.    I thought the first single "Through" was the best example of them getting something like their own sound with the joint vocals but for the most part they produce a result that is no more (probably less) than the sum of the parts so I can't see the point.   I'd rate the opening 4 tracks maybe an 8/10 and the rest of the album a 6/10.  It's just more of the same old same old from Frontiers in the song writing department .  And not sure why they had to cover "Need You Now" - I haven't managed to figure out who the female vocal was there either.

So yeah.........one or two tracks I might return to but otherwise rather forgettable

Anthony Fantano's reviews are so arbitrary lol, he pretty much dislikes this album for the exact same reasons that he believes Sunbather is one of the best metal records of the decade. Never understood all of the love Sunbather gets, can already tell from the first listen that this one is better.



LLNN: FFO: Lo! :neverusethis: but seriously Rapture has some of the most intense metal instrumentation and thickest guitar riffs man, crazy stuff
Biti Bam: One of the best releases of the year, apart from Millions and The Grid everything has sunken in and I'm really starting to dig this thing as one album instead of 2 separate discs.
Ancestors: Not as hype as the lead single off their upcoming album (The Warm Glow) but the album cover is fucking cool and the music is I guess average to good doom/post-metal, which is probably not really good enouh for me to give it more spins.
